package log
import (
"bytes"
"encoding/json"
"log/slog"
"net/http"
"net/http/httptest"
"testing"
"unsafe"
pkgerrors "github.com/pkg/errors"
"github.com/stretchr/testify/assert"
"github.com/smallstep/certificates/logging"
)
type stackTracedError struct{}
func (stackTracedError) Error() string {
return "a stacktraced error"
}
func (stackTracedError) StackTrace() pkgerrors.StackTrace {
f := struct{}{}
return pkgerrors.StackTrace{ // fake stacktrace
pkgerrors.Frame(unsafe.Pointer(&f)),
pkgerrors.Frame(unsafe.Pointer(&f)),
}
}
func TestError(t *testing.T) {
var buf bytes.Buffer
logger := slog.New(slog.NewJSONHandler(&buf, &slog.HandlerOptions{}))
req := httptest.NewRequest("GET", "/test", http.NoBody)
reqWithLogger := req.WithContext(WithErrorLogger(req.Context(), func(w http.ResponseWriter, r *http.Request, err error) {
if err != nil {
logger.ErrorContext(r.Context(), "request failed", slog.Any("error", err))
}
}))
tests := []struct {
name string
error
rw http.ResponseWriter
r *http.Request
isFieldCarrier bool
isSlogLogger bool
stepDebug bool
expectStackTrace bool
}{
{"noLogger", nil, nil, req, false, false, false, false},
{"noError", nil, logging.NewResponseLogger(httptest.NewRecorder()), req, true, false, false, false},
{"noErrorDebug", nil, logging.NewResponseLogger(httptest.NewRecorder()), req, true, false, true, false},
{"anError", assert.AnError, logging.NewResponseLogger(httptest.NewRecorder()), req, true, false, false, false},
{"anErrorDebug", assert.AnError, logging.NewResponseLogger(httptest.NewRecorder()), req, true, false, true, false},
{"stackTracedError", new(stackTracedError), logging.NewResponseLogger(httptest.NewRecorder()), req, true, false, true, true},
{"stackTracedErrorDebug", new(stackTracedError), logging.NewResponseLogger(httptest.NewRecorder()), req, true, false, true, true},
{"slogWithNoError", nil, logging.NewResponseLogger(httptest.NewRecorder()), reqWithLogger, true, true, false, false},
{"slogWithError", assert.AnError, logging.NewResponseLogger(httptest.NewRecorder()), reqWithLogger, true, true, false, false},
}
for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
if tt.stepDebug {
t.Setenv("STEPDEBUG", "1")
} else {
t.Setenv("STEPDEBUG", "0")
}
Error(tt.rw, tt.r, tt.error)
// return early if test case doesn't use logger
if !tt.isFieldCarrier && !tt.isSlogLogger {
return
}
if tt.isFieldCarrier {
fields := tt.rw.(logging.ResponseLogger).Fields()
// expect the error field to be (not) set and to be the same error that was fed to Error
if tt.error == nil {
assert.Nil(t, fields["error"])
} else {
assert.Same(t, tt.error, fields["error"])
}
// check if stack-trace is set when expected
if _, hasStackTrace := fields["stack-trace"]; tt.expectStackTrace && !hasStackTrace {
t.Error(`ResponseLogger["stack-trace"] not set`)
} else if !tt.expectStackTrace && hasStackTrace {
t.Error(`ResponseLogger["stack-trace"] was set`)
}
}
if tt.isSlogLogger {
b := buf.Bytes()
if tt.error == nil {
assert.Empty(t, b)
} else if assert.NotEmpty(t, b) {
var m map[string]any
assert.NoError(t, json.Unmarshal(b, &m))
assert.Equal(t, tt.error.Error(), m["error"])
}
buf.Reset()
}
})
}
}
